Hoop legends shoot for charity

Some of the country’s greatest basketball legends will shoot some hoops at a tournament over the weekend in a bid to raise much-needed funds for charity.

Former Ireland international Mark Keenan, shooting sensation Tom O’Sullivan, and Sandie Fitzgibbon are among the basketball greats from the 1980s who will take part in an inaugural two-day Masters tournament at Neptune Stadium in Cork to raise funds for Marymount Hospice.

Other big names from the past set to display their skills include Deora Marsh and Liam McHale from Ballina Basketball Club, Ricardo Leonard, who played for Tigers and Neptune, and former international John McHale.
